cmd/testwrapper, tstest: move test sharding out of test code
Previously, sharding required tests to opt in by calling tstest.Shard, which used a process-global counter to assign each test to a shard. This had two problems: most tests didn't call it, so they ran on every shard (defeating the purpose), and shard assignments were unstable (depended on call order, so adding a test could reshuffle others). Remove tstest.Shard and tstest.SkipOnUnshardedCI entirely. Instead, have testwrapper implement sharding automatically for all tests: when TS_TEST_SHARD=N/M is set, it uses "go list -json" (no compilation) to find test source files, scans them for top-level Test/Benchmark/ Example/Fuzz function names, and filters by fnv32a(name) % M == N-1. The filtered names are passed as an anchored -run regex to go test. Using go list instead of "go test -list" avoids linking the test binary twice (Go's build cache does not cache test binary linking).
